屏幕截图是我收到的错误。我试图在包myconnectoracle中的类AdminManager中使用包CIS4362Connect1中包含的类ConnectDB。为什么我不能导入这个类?
答案 0 :(得分:0)
正如上面的评论所示,您的ConnectDB
可能不公开,为了在package
之外使用该关闭,必须将其声明为public
请参阅: Access control 文档
已编辑:(解决方案)
问题是包是区分大小写的,在两个包声明中都有不同的情况。
在ConnectDB类中,您可以使用小写cis
。
答案 1 :(得分:0)
据我所知,您正在寻找的课程未在当前项目中定义。尝试使用您在库中查找的包来引用项目,或者只是移动包/类。
答案 2 :(得分:0)
我刚刚遇到了一个非常相似的问题,我的一个班级莫名其妙地无法导入。无论如何,我尝试构建该项目,尽管到处都显示错误,但它确实构建成功。
将包移动到我的 ide 中的另一个位置,然后将它移回它应该位于的位置,以某种方式解决了我的问题。